Congresswoman Nicole Malliotakis (NY-11) applauds the inclusion of her bipartisan legislation, H.R. 2510, The American-Hellenic-Israeli Eastern Mediterranean Counterterrorism and Maritime Security Partnership Act of 2025, successful the State Department Reauthorization measure precocious by the House Foreign Affairs Committee.
The measure, introduced with Congressman Thomas Kean (NJ-07), Congressman Josh Gottheimer (NJ-05), and Congressman Dan Goldman (NY-10), establishes a security-focused “3+1” model among the United States, Israel, Greece, and the Republic of Cyprus to heighten counterterrorism and maritime security.
The provisions fortify this concern by creating caller parliamentary and executive-level practice groups; launching 2 information grooming programs, CERBERUS, focused connected counterterrorism astatine the Cyprus Center for Land, Open Seas, and Port Security (CYCLOPS), and TRIREME, a maritime information programme astatine the Greek Souda Bay Naval Base; and modernizing the decades-old U.S. arms embargo connected Cyprus.

This measure removes restrictions connected defence articles and information assistance to the Republic of Cyprus and mandates the improvement of broad strategies for counterterrorism and maritime information cooperation. It authorizes funds for facilities and instrumentality astatine the Cyprus Center for Land, Open-Seas, and Port Security, the Greek Souda Naval Base, and each grooming programs. Additionally, this measure increases IMET backing for each 3 spouse nations.
